python3 分割list

原list

old_list = ['Tom','12歲','女生','Larry','14歲','女生','XiaoMing''13歲','男生']

可以看出來,原來的list是有規律的,三個一小組。想把它們分開三個三個分開。

最終效果

new_list = [['Tom','12歲','女生'],['Larry','14歲','女生'],['XiaoMing''13歲','男生']]

實現

new_list = [old_list[i:i+3] for i in range(0,len(old_list),3)]
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章